Casino Apps: Convenience at Your Fingertips
The Allure of Mobile Gaming
Casino apps are specifically designed for mobile devices, offering a dedicated gaming experience. They’re typically downloaded from your device’s app store (Google Play Store for Android, or the App Store for iOS). The primary advantage is convenience. You can access your favourite games with a single tap, anytime, anywhere, provided you have an internet connection. This portability is a huge draw for many players in Ireland, allowing for gaming on the go, whether you’re commuting, relaxing at home, or even taking a break at work (though we recommend checking your workplace policy!).
Advantages of Casino Apps
- Optimized Performance: Apps are usually optimized for the specific hardware of your device, leading to smoother gameplay, faster loading times, and better graphics.
- User-Friendly Interface: Developers design apps with mobile users in mind, creating intuitive interfaces that are easy to navigate, even on smaller screens.
- Push Notifications: Apps can send you notifications about promotions, new games, and other important updates, keeping you informed and engaged.
- Offline Play (Sometimes): Some apps offer the option to play certain games offline, allowing you to practice or enjoy a limited experience without an internet connection.
- Dedicated Security: Apps often have built-in security features, such as biometric login (fingerprint or facial recognition), to protect your account.
Potential Drawbacks of Casino Apps
- Storage Space: Apps take up storage space on your device, which can be a concern if you have limited capacity.
- Compatibility Issues: Not all apps are compatible with all devices. Older devices may not be supported, or the app might not run optimally.
- Updates: You’ll need to keep the app updated to ensure you have the latest features, security patches, and game versions.
- Limited Game Selection (Sometimes): While the selection is usually extensive, some apps might offer a slightly smaller range of games compared to their browser-based counterparts.
Browser-Based Platforms: The Web’s Casino Gateway
Accessing Casinos Through Your Web Browser
Browser-based platforms are accessed directly through your web browser (Chrome, Safari, Firefox, etc.). You simply visit the casino’s website and log in to your account. This approach offers a different set of advantages and disadvantages compared to casino apps.
Advantages of Browser-Based Platforms
- No Download Required: You don’t need to download or install anything, saving you storage space and eliminating compatibility concerns.
- Cross-Platform Compatibility: Browser-based platforms are generally accessible on any device with a web browser and an internet connection, including computers, tablets, and smartphones.
- Large Game Selection: Many online casinos offer their full game libraries through their websites, providing access to a wider variety of games.
- Instant Access: You can quickly access the casino from any device without needing to download an app.
- Easy Updates: Updates are handled by the casino, so you don’t need to manually update anything.
Potential Drawbacks of Browser-Based Platforms
- Performance Dependence: The performance of browser-based platforms depends on your internet connection and the processing power of your device. Slower connections can lead to lag and a less enjoyable experience.
- Less Optimized Interface: While websites are becoming increasingly mobile-friendly, the interface might not be as optimized for smaller screens as a dedicated app.
- Security Concerns: You’ll need to ensure the website is secure (look for the padlock icon in the address bar) to protect your personal and financial information.
- Notifications: You might not receive the same level of push notifications as you would with an app.
Making the Right Choice: Which is Best for You?
Factors to Consider
The best choice between a casino app and a browser-based platform depends on your individual preferences and circumstances. Consider these factors:
- Device: What device are you primarily using? If you have a newer smartphone or tablet, a casino app might be a good option. If you use a computer or have an older device, a browser-based platform might be more suitable.
- Internet Connection: Do you have a reliable and fast internet connection? If so, both options should work well. If your connection is spotty, a casino app might offer a more stable experience.
- Storage Space: Do you have limited storage space on your device? If so, a browser-based platform is the better choice.
- Gaming Habits: Do you prefer to play on the go, or do you primarily play at home? If you like to play on the go, a casino app offers greater convenience.
- Game Selection: Are there specific games you want to play? Check if both the app and the browser platform offer the games you’re interested in.
